Abstract

The utility model discloses an embedded system based elevator security monitoring device which comprises a processor module, a signal acquiring module, a video capture module and a data transceiving module, wherein the processor module is connected with the signal acquiring module, the video capture module and the data transceiving module respectively and is used for analyzing a sensing signal and transmitting a control signal to other modules; the signal acquiring module is used for acquiring all sensing data in an elevator and transmitting the sensing data to the processor module; the data transceiving module is used for data interaction with an external terminal; the video capture module is used for acquiring video image information in the elevator. Different sensors are used for acquiring the environment information and the operation parameters in the elevator, various data information in the elevator can be mastered in real time, the accuracy is high, the signal updating is rapid, and the security of the elevator work is improved to a great extent.

A kind of elevator safety control monitor unit based on embedded system, comprise Cortex A8 treater, 3G data transmit-receive module, video acquisition module, display module, sound and light alarm module and signal acquisition module, wherein, described in video acquisition module, can adopt common camera to carry out video acquisition; The collecting sensor signal device that signal acquisition module comprises polytype sensor and is connected with various kinds of sensors, wherein sensor can comprise collecting sensor signal device, Temperature Humidity Sensor, noise transducer, weight sensor, acceleration pick-up, position transduser, Smoke Sensor, limit sensors, magnetic pickup device, infrared pickoff etc., certainly, in concrete reality, the type of sensor also can be done corresponding variation according to different applied environments; Collecting sensor signal device Real-time Collection sensor signal, and the signal collecting is sent to Cortex A8 treater, interface type between various kinds of sensors and collecting sensor signal device mainly comprises the imported interface of IO and analog input interface as shown in Figure 2, IO incoming signal enters acquisition module through light-coupled isolation, and analog quantity enters acquisition module through overrange conversion.
When elevator is in running order, the sensor signal of collecting sensor signal device Real-time Collection Temperature Humidity Sensor, noise transducer, weight sensor, acceleration pick-up, position transduser, Smoke Sensor, limit sensors, magnetic pickup device, infrared pickoff, and the signal collecting is sent to Cortex A8 treater; Cortex A8 treater is processed signal, and the running orbit of elevator is depicted as to graphics signal, is sent to data monitor center by 3G data transmit-receive module simultaneously; When elevator has, occur extremely when possible, Cortex A8 treater outputs to 3G data transmit-receive module by alarm signal, by 3G data transmit-receive module, sends signal to elevator monitoring chamber, community and data monitor center; LCDs driver drives Liquid Crystal Display is presented at the running state information of elevator on screen, and sound and light alarm module is sent sound and light alarm, reminds elevator ride personnel to take care.
